Output fb78580a3f0dcfee9b20749469b8e332addf6fd03a1126cbc45a7a09193b6585:3

value
23328272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7466bdcbb2257d144dc04d77951180ef41ceb3f4 OP_EQUAL
address
MJWdhHAA2Ua89V5BqcsWu2xf5qcv9DjkSu
transaction
fb78580a3f0dcfee9b20749469b8e332addf6fd03a1126cbc45a7a09193b6585
spent
true